Output 5e8999e61e56aae36f28341e37991bb885d6a2302d47e5707d745c0050e520b2:0

value
8080000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e295c55ff7da179b3bc6e8b8e3df34d56616e758 OP_EQUALVERIFY OP_CHECKSIG
address
1Mf58dF7LteXhTmf55ekXZCumdNmFPAagx
transaction
5e8999e61e56aae36f28341e37991bb885d6a2302d47e5707d745c0050e520b2
spent
true